Understanding Performance Enhancements for a 75 HP Boost
Reaching a 75 horsepower increase isn't a single-mod job; it usually requires a combination of upgrades that work together. The exact path depends on your engine (Cummins diesel vs. Hemi gas), your emissions standards, and whether you want to keep the powertrain stock internally. Below are the most common modifications that collectively contribute to this power level.
ECU Tuning / ECM Remapping
Tuning is the single most cost-effective way to unlock significant power on modern Ram 2500s. For the Cummins 6.7L, a custom tune can add 50–80 hp and 100–150 lb-ft of torque to the rear wheels, often without any other hardware. For the Hemi 6.4L, tuning adds a more conservative 20–30 hp on pump gas, but combined with bolt-ons it can get you closer to 75 hp. Tuning also adjusts transmission shift points, throttle response, and torque management. Costs range from $300–$1,500 depending on whether you use a handheld tuner (like an Edge or Bully Dog) or a custom dyno tune from a reputable shop like Hemifever.
Cold Air Intake Systems
A high-flow cold air intake replaces the restrictive factory airbox with a larger filter and smoother tubing. While it rarely adds more than 10–15 hp on its own, it is essential for supporting a tuned engine. The Ram 2500 draws air from the fender or behind the grille; aftermarket systems (like S&B, aFe, or Volant) improve airflow without sucking in hot underhood air. Expect to pay $200–$500 for a quality intake. Pair with a tune to see the full benefit and ensure the engine's air/fuel ratio stays optimal.
Exhaust System Upgrades
Freeing up exhaust flow reduces backpressure and helps the engine breathe. On a diesel, a 4-inch or 5-inch turbo-back exhaust (with or without a muffler) can add 15–25 hp with tuning. On the Hemi, a cat-back system (3-inch or larger) adds a modest 5–10 hp but improves sound. Diesel owners should consider a delete pipe or DPF-back system—but be aware that removing emissions equipment is illegal for on-road use in many states and voids warranties. Costs: $500–$2,000 depending on material (stainless is best) and whether you include a high-flow catalytic converter or muffler.
Turbocharger or Supercharger Installation
For a 75 hp increase, you likely do not need a full turbo or supercharger swap unless you start with a naturally aspirated Hemi. However, on the Cummins, upgrading to a larger, more efficient turbo (like a BorgWarner S300 or S400 series) can add 50–100 hp, but this is expensive and often requires supporting mods (fuel system, head studs). For the Hemi, a supercharger kit (like ProCharger or Whipple) delivers 100+ hp instantly, but costs $5,000–$8,000 plus installation. A better value for 75 hp is tuning + boltons unless you plan to go much higher later.
High-Performance Fuel Injectors (Diesel Focus)
On the Cummins, larger injectors (e.g., 75–100% over stock) allow more fuel to be delivered, which is necessary when increasing boost. Adding injectors can contribute 30–50 hp, but they must be matched with a custom tune and larger CP3 or CP4 injection pump. Costs: $200–$600 per injector (set of 6) plus installation. On the Hemi, injectors rarely need upgrading for 75 hp unless you go forced induction; stock injectors can handle bolt-on mods.
Cost Breakdown for Achieving 75 Horsepower
The total cost varies widely based on your engine, current modifications, and whether you install parts yourself. Below is a realistic budget range for a combination that reliably yields 75 hp.
- Budget Diesel Build (6.7L Cummins): ECU tune + cold air intake + 4-inch turbo-back exhaust = $1,000–$2,500 (DIY install). This combo typically nets 60–80 hp.
- Premium Diesel Build: Add larger injectors and a bigger turbo (or just a tune + intake/exhaust from a top brand) = $3,500–$6,500 with professional tuning.
- Hemi 6.4L Build: Tune + cold air + cat-back exhaust + optional throttle body spacer = $1,200–$2,000 (DIY). Yields ~30–40 hp; to hit 75 hp, you’ll need a supercharger kit + supporting mods = $7,000–$10,000 installed.
- Used/Refurbished Parts: You can save 20–40% by buying used intakes, exhausts, or tuners from forums like Cummins Forum or Facebook Marketplace—but inspect carefully for damage or missing parts.
Factors That Influence the Final Price Tag
Beyond the parts themselves, several real-world factors can shift your budget dramatically. Plan for these when estimating.
- Labor Costs: Turbo swaps, exhaust header work, and supercharger installations can take 8–20 hours. Shop rates of $100–$150/hr add up quickly. DIY saves big but requires tools and expertise.
- Vehicle Condition & Year: Older Ram 2500s (pre-2010) may have rusted bolts or aging gaskets that need replacement during mods. Newer trucks (2013+) with DEF and EGR systems require careful tuning to avoid derate codes.
- Emissions Compliance: In California and other CARB states, you must use 50-state legal parts. A CARB-legal tune or intake costs more but prevents trouble during smog checks. Illegal products (DPF deletes, no cats) can result in steep fines.
- Brand Reputation and R&D: Well-known brands like BD Diesel, Mopar Performance, and aFe invest in R&D and customer support. Cheaper knock-offs may flow only slightly less, but fitment issues and poor materials can cost you more in the long run.
- Dyno Tuning vs. Custom E‐Mail Tunes: A dyno tune (live on a rolling road) costs $400–$800 but optimizes timing, fuel, and boost for your specific truck. E-mail calibrations from a trusted tuner like SocalTuner are cheaper ($200–$400) but rely on you logging data and sending it back.
- Supporting Mods: Adding power without upgrading transmission cooling, fuel pressure, or boost gauges can lead to failures. Budget $200–$500 for robust monitoring (e.g., Edge CTS3 or Banks iDash).
Choosing the Right Combination for Your Driving Style
A 75 hp boost isn't one-size-fits-all. Here’s how to prioritize mods based on how you use your Ram 2500.
- Heavy Tower: Focus on low-end torque. A diesel tune with 40–50 hp gain and stronger transmission tuning will help pull heavy loads without overspeeding the turbo. Add a mild exhaust and intake.
- Daily Driver: Balance power and reliability. A cold air intake and cat-back exhaust combined with a mild tune keeps the truck civil. Avoid extreme injector or turbo upgrades that complicate cold starts and idling.
- Off-Road or Light Towing: More top-end power is enjoyable. Consider a supercharger on the Hemi or a larger turbo on the diesel. Keep a close eye on EGTs (exhaust gas temperatures) with a gauge.
- Show/Performance Builds: You may want a complete package including injectors, turbo, intercooler, and fuel system. Costs escalate quickly; expect $10,000+ for a 150 hp build.
Potential Benefits Beyond Horsepower Gains
Investing in these upgrades can improve your truck in several other ways, making the expense more worthwhile.
- Improved Towing Capacity: More available torque at lower RPMs reduces downshifting and keeps the trans cooler. A tuned Ram 2500 can handle heavy fifth-wheel trailers more confidently.
- Better Fuel Efficiency Under Load: With a well-calibrated tune, the engine operates more efficiently—especially on the highway. Some diesel owners report a 1–2 mpg improvement when not towing, though the gain vanishes when acceleration is aggressive.
- Enhanced Driving Experience: Throttle response sharpens, turbo lag diminishes, and exhaust sound becomes more aggressive. This makes the truck feel livelier every day.
- Increased Resale Value: Tasteful, professional upgrades can attract buyers—especially if you include documentation of the tune and dyno results. A fully stock truck may appeal more to purists, but a modest build might fetch a premium from the right buyer.
Potential Drawbacks and Considerations
No upgrade is without risks. Be aware of these before spending money.
- Warranty Voiding: Modifications can void the factory powertrain warranty. If your Ram 2500 is still under warranty, consider a truck-specific tuner that offers "return to stock" capability (like the DiabloSport i3). Note that dealers can detect ECM flash counter counts even after reflashing.
- Reliability and Heat: Adding 75 hp stresses cooling systems, especially on the 6.7L Cummins (which runs high cylinder pressures). Upgrade the intercooler or coolant if you tow heavy in hot climates. Head gasket failures are rare at this power level but not impossible.
- Transmission Longevity: The 68RFE (2013+ diesel) and 66RFE (older) can handle 75 extra hp with careful tuning, but the ZF 8HP75 found in Hemi trucks is more robust. Consider a shift kit or upgraded valve body if your truck sees heavy use.
- Emissions and Legal Issues: Many states enforce strict emissions regulations. Removing DPF/SCR on a diesel or punching out catalytic converters on a gas engine may lead to registration refusal or fines. EPA enforcement is active; expect penalties of several thousand dollars if caught.
- Drivability Changes: A tune that adds serious power can make throttle jerky in parking lots. Look for tuners that offer “aggressive” and “economy” modes so you can switch on the fly.
Realistic Example: 75 HP on a 2018 Ram 2500 Cummins
Let’s build a hypothetical but workable setup for a 2018 6.7L Cummins with 65,000 miles. Owner wants 75 hp for towing a 14,000-lb fifth wheel across the Rockies.
- ECU tune (custom dyno by a local diesel shop): $600
- Cold air intake (S&B): $320
- 4-inch turbo-back exhaust (MagnaFlow, stainless, with muffler): $1,100
- Transmission temperature gauge (Edge Insight): $280
- Installation (exhaust only, DIY intake and tune): $0
- Total: $2,300
- Result: ~80 hp gain at the wheels, 15 lb-ft extra below 2,000 RPM, and lower EGTs during climbs. Owner gains 1 mpg towing on flat ground. Truck remains reliable with occasional healthy boost.
